Grace

Today at Stew Leonard's (grocery store) I ran into my first "rejection." My little family had a receipt for over $100 from the store, and you can use it to get a free ice cream out front. I tried to give it to another woman who was standing in line for ice cream. She was holding a toddler on her hip. She was so uncomfortable and resistant to my offer. It just made me reflect on giving and getting and how suspicious we are of other people trying to do nice things.

Day 2: Not sleeping in

When my husband came to bed at 12:30, I knew that, despite it being his turn to get up with the baby in the morning, I would be giving him a break.

The other opportunity to give that I've had so far was my place in line at Long's Drugs. A woman who'd been waiting in the next line over, which was moving quite slowly, moved to my line. I let her go ahead.. she'd been waiting longer. Interestingly, she was in a huge hurry. You wouldn't have known it from her calm demeanor.

Day 9

Day 9, May 30
Today we mailed 5 old cell phones to myboneyard.com. They have no reward value, so it was our gift to the planet and the future to see that they were disposed of in a responsible manner. Currently, the Boneyard requires that each phone be shipped separately, so we also got rid of 5 recycled padded envelopes.

At dinner Jim and I helped my mom with some correspondence for her '08-'09 5th graders.
